Walker Dunlop Market Risk Analysis

Today, many novice investors tend to focus exclusively on investment returns with little concern for Walker Dunlop's investment risk. Standard deviation is the most common way to measure market volatility of stocks, such as Walker Dunlop, and traders can use it to determine the average amount a Walker Dunlop's price has deviated from the expected return over a period of time. It is calculated by determining the expected price for the established period and then subtracting this figure from each price point. The differences are then squared, summed, and averaged to produce the variance.

Evaluating Walker Dunlop's performance can involve analyzing a variety of financial metrics and factors. Some of the key considerations to evaluate Walker Dunlop's stock performance include:
  • Analyzing Walker Dunlop's financial statements, including its income statement, balance sheet, and cash flow statement, helps in understanding its overall financial health and growth potential.
  • Getting a closer look at valuation ratios like price-to-earnings (P/E) ratio, price-to-sales (P/S) ratio, and price-to-book (P/B) ratio help in understanding whether Walker Dunlop's stock is overvalued or undervalued compared to its peers.
  • Examining Walker Dunlop's industry or sector and how it is performing can give you an idea of its growth potential and how it is positioned relative to its competitors.
  • Evaluating Walker Dunlop's management team can have a significant impact on its success or failure. Reviewing the track record and experience of Walker Dunlop's management team can help you assess the Company's leadership.
  • Pay attention to analyst opinions and ratings of Walker Dunlop's stock. These opinions can provide insight into Walker Dunlop's potential for growth and whether the stock is currently undervalued or overvalued.
It's essential to remember that evaluating Walker Dunlop's stock performance is not an exact science, and many factors can impact Walker Dunlop's stock market price. Therefore, it's also important to diversify your portfolio and not rely solely on one company or stock for your investments.
